Protodyakonov scale has a formula. f = R/10. The f-value is used for estimating the scratch resistance of rock and its stability after drilling. The R-value refers to the uniaxial compressive strength of rock in MPa. Protodyakonov scale includes 10 levels. The higher the level of rock, the easier it is to crush.

Mainly in USA, the term circulating load is more often used than the circulation factor.Circulating load is percentage of coarse return in relation to fines & it can be calculated by : Coarse return TPH X 100 / Mill output TPH.Normal range of cirulating load in a conventional close circuit ball mill is around 100-200%.

In 1907, Fuller proposed the formula for maximum density gradation: Pi = 100 (di/D)0.45, where Pi = % passing sieve size di, and D = maximum size of aggregate. Ideally, the reduction ratio of a jaw crusher should be 6-to-1. There are different ways to calculate reduction ratio, but the best way is something called the P80 factor. The reduction ratio is then calculated by comparing the input feed size passing 80 percent versus the discharge size that passes 80 percent.
